Kazuto Ogawa is new president and CEO of Canon USA

Canon U.S.A., Inc. announced the appointment of Kazuto Ogawa as President and CEO of Canon U.S.A. Inc., effective April 1, 2020, along with other senior executive promotions. He succeeds the retiring Yoruku “Joe” Adachi. Ogawa has almost 40 years of experience with Canon since beginning his career with Canon Inc. in 1981. Xerox abandons tender off for HP, due to COVID-19 pandemic

Xerox Holdings Corp. is abandoning its effort to acquire much-larger rival HP Inc., citing the “macroeconomic and market turmoil” caused the COVID-19 pandemic. The company said it is withdrawing its $24-per-share tender offer to acquire HP and will also no longer seek to nominate  a slate of candidates to HP’s Board of Directors.
